There has been a belief in the country for a long time that women should not go to temples or worship during their periods. Many people associate it with the weakness of the body and the need for rest, while religious traditions also mention many rules regarding this time.

The famous saint of Vrindavan-Mathura, Premanand Maharaj, has also shared his views on this subject.

What does Premanand Maharaj say about worshiping during periods?

Maharaj says that menstruation is a natural process in women’s body, which comes every month and is part of the purification of the body. According to him, at this time a woman should take bath and remain clean and if possible, should have darshan of God from a distance. He says that it is not necessary to serve in the temple or touch the puja material directly, but the most important thing is devotion of the mind. Access to God is by purity of feelings, not mere physical presence.

What is mentioned in the scriptures?

Premanand Maharaj explains that according to the scriptures, women should abstain from religious activities like making prasad or worship during the first three days of their periods. This time is considered to give rest to the body and maintain mental peace. According to Maharaj, during this time women should only chant the name of God and give themselves complete rest.

Rules to follow during menstruation

In the end he said that during the three days of menstruation, women must do bhajan, chant and remember God mentally. One should not stay away from devotion, because true worship happens only with purity of mind.
